    For a parametrized family of piecewise expanding interval maps \(T_a: [0,1] \rightarrow [0,1]\) and a point \(X(a) \in [0,1]\), \textit{D. Schnellmann} [Discrete Contin. Dyn. Syst. 31, No. 3, 877--911 (2011; Zbl 1253.37044)] showed for almost all parameters \(a\) that \(X(a)\) is typical with respect to an invariant measure of \(T_a\) which is absolutely continuous with respect to Lebesgue measure. In the paper under review, the author proves a corresponding result under different assumptions than those of Schnellmann [loc. cit.]. He also extends the result to classes of mappings not previously included in Schnellmann's [loc. cit.] results.
